One is our God and Father!

Author: B. S. Ingemann Hymnal: The Lutheran Hymnary #468 (1913) Meter: 7.8.7.8.7.6.7.6.7.6.7.6 Lyrics: 1 One is our God and Father! The flock and all its shepherds cry; One Spirit us doth gather, One is our Lord, who reigns on high; One well of life doth lave us, One hope our souls inspires, One faith, our stay, doth save us, One love us ever fires, One peace our spirits blesses, One fight for our reward, One end of all distresses, One life in Christ our Lord. 2 One in the Spirit's union, We onward march, a pilgrim throng, And sing in sweet communion The ransomed Zion's victor-song; Through night and tribulation, Through death our way we wend, With hope and expectation To see our journey's end-- The cross, the grave, death's prison, We leave behind, and rise To meet our Savior risen, And enter Paradise. Topics: The Church Year Seventeenth Sunday after Trinity; The Church Year Seventeenth Sunday after Trinity; Communion of Saints; Pilgrimage Tune Title: [One is our God and Father]

I Know My Faith Is Founded

Author: Erdmann Neumeister, 1671-1756 Hymnal: Christian Worship #797 (2021) Meter: 7.8.7.8.7.6.7.6.7.6.7.6 Lyrics: 1 I know my faith is founded on Jesus Christ, my God and Lord; and this my faith confessing, unmoved I stand upon his Word. Our reason cannot fathom the truth of God profound; who trusts in worldly wisdom relies on shifting ground. God's Word is all-sufficient, it makes divinely sure, and, trusting in its wisdom, my faith shall rest secure. 2 Increase my faith, dear Savior, for Satan seeks by night and day to rob me of this treasure and take my hope of bliss away. But, Lord, with you beside me I shall be undismayed; and led by your good Spirit, I shall be unafraid. Abide with me, O Savior, a firmer faith bestow; then I shall bid defiance to ev'ry evil foe. 3 In faith, Lord, let me serve you; though persecution, grief, and pain should seek to overwhelm me, let me a steadfast trust retain. And then at my departure, at home with you I'll be, and there will I inherit all you have promised me. In life and death, Lord, keep me until your heav'n I gain, where I by your great mercy the end of faith attain. Topics: Trust Scripture: 1 Corinthians 1:18-25 Languages: English Tune Title: NUN LOB, MEIN SEEL
